Customer Success Story: Yang Xiao Xian Mango Dessert

Liang Wei Liaw • July 5, 2024

Yang Xiao Xian Mango Dessert, a beloved dessert chain known for its delightful mango-based treats, has seen remarkable success by implementing a comprehensive membership and referral program. By leveraging top-up incentives and referral vouchers, the business has not only attracted a large number of new members but also ensured repeat visits and increased customer loyalty across its multiple outlets.


Top-Up Incentives Driving Membership Sign-Ups

To encourage customers to join their membership program, Yang Xiao Xian Mango Dessert introduced an attractive top-up incentive. Customers who top up their membership account with $20 receive an additional $2, making it $22 in total. This affordable and appealing offer has enticed many customers to sign up for the membership program to enjoy better deals on their favorite mango desserts.

Ensuring Repeat Visits with Expiry Dates The top-up value comes with an expiry date, encouraging members to return within a specified time frame to utilize their e-wallet balance. This strategy not only boosts sales but also ensures that members frequently visit Yang Xiao Xian Mango Dessert to redeem their top-up value, fostering a habit of regular patronage.


Seamless Multi-Outlet Membership

Yang Xiao Xian Mango Dessert’s membership program is designed to offer a seamless experience across all their outlets. Members can top up, earn, and redeem their rewards at any location, making it convenient for customers to enjoy their benefits no matter where they are. This multi-outlet membership system has enhanced customer satisfaction and loyalty, as it offers flexibility and convenience.


Boosting Growth with Referral Vouchers

To further drive customer acquisition and engagement, Yang Xiao Xian Mango Dessert introduced a referral voucher program. Members receive a voucher when they refer a friend, and the referred friend also enjoys a special discount on their first purchase. This referral system has been highly effective in attracting new customers and expanding the loyal customer base, as satisfied members enthusiastically share their positive experiences with friends and family.

T urning diners into loyal promoters is the best way to get new customers. Arguably even better than social media marketing. Referral marketing is one of the most cost-effective ways to grow your profits while building a strong community around your brand. Why Referrals Work Referrals work because they rely on trust and personal recommendations , which are far more persuasive than traditional advertising. Customers who come via referrals are already pre-disposed to like your brand—they’re more likely to return, spend more, and even become repeat advocates themselves. Advantages of Referral Marketing: Cost-Efficient Growth Traditional advertising can be expensive, especially for small F&B businesses. Referral marketing leverages your existing customers as promoters, drastically reducing your marketing spend. Each happy customer essentially becomes a free marketing channel. Stronger Retention Referred customers already have a level of trust in your brand. This makes them more likely to come back multiple times , try new menu items, and participate in loyalty programs. Brand Advocacy and Credibility Word-of-mouth is the ultimate credibility booster. When someone recommends your restaurant, it positions your brand as trustworthy and reliable. This is particularly valuable in the F&B industry, where trust and reviews influence customer decisions heavily. Exponential Reach Each customer has multiple friends, family members, and colleagues. A well-designed referral program can turn a single loyal customer into a network of potential repeat customers , multiplying your growth opportunities. How to Implement a Referral Program Incentivize Sharing Offer tangible rewards such as discounts, free menu items, or loyalty points for successful referrals. For example: “Refer a friend and get 10% off your next visit” “Your friend gets 10% off their first order, and you earn loyalty points” Incentives motivate participation while also ensuring the reward is tied to actual customer acquisition. Digital-Friendly Tools QR codes, mobile apps, and social media sharing links make referrals effortless. You can integrate these directly into your ordering system, e-wallet, or loyalty app to track successful referrals automatically . Personalized Messaging Generic messages are easy to ignore. Craft personalized invitations like: “Hi Sarah, invite a friend and both of you enjoy a free dessert on your next visit!” Personalization improves engagement and encourages customers to actively participate. Create Shareable Experiences The more memorable the experience, the more likely customers are to share it. Think visually stunning dishes, unique beverages, cozy interiors, or excellent customer service. Encourage sharing by adding Instagram or TikTok handles on receipts or table displays. Leverage Existing Loyalty Programs Combine referral programs with your existing loyalty system. For instance, customers can earn double points when they refer a friend , providing an added layer of incentive. Track and Optimize To ensure your referral program is effective, monitor: Number of new customers acquired through referrals Repeat visits and average spend of referred customers Engagement rates with referral campaigns (QR scans, app shares, clicks) Adjust your program based on insights. For example, if digital referrals outperform physical coupons, invest more in mobile-friendly solutions. Takeaway Referral marketing isn’t just a promotional tool—it’s a profit accelerator . By rewarding loyal customers, making sharing easy, and creating memorable experiences, your F&B business can enjoy sustainable growth, stronger customer loyalty, and higher revenue . One of the biggest challenges of running an F&B business in Singapore apart from high rental and manpower is keeping customers engaged so they return again and again. Many businesses rely on email marketing , but let’s be honest — most emails end up ignored, unopened, or worse, lost in spam folders. That’s where WhatsApp marketing changes the game. Higher Engagement and Open Rates Unlike emails, WhatsApp messages land directly in your customer’s phone inbox, where they are far more likely to be opened. Studies show WhatsApp open rates can reach 90%+, compared to just 20–30% for email. That means your promos, loyalty offers, and updates actually get seen. Personalized, Targeted Campaigns With Minty’s WhatsApp integration, you can broadcast messages to specific member groups. Some examples include: 🔄 Re-engagement campaigns : Win back customers who haven’t visited in a while. ⭐ Regular engagement messages : Keep your brand top-of-mind with loyal diners. 🎁 Promotions & eVoucher notifications : Drive redemptions and boost sales. 📦 Order status updates : Keep customers informed when they order online. Stronger Customer Loyalty Email often feels one-way and impersonal, but WhatsApp is conversational by nature. By using it to share timely, relevant content, you create a stronger connection with your members and increase the likelihood of repeat visits. A Smarter Choice for F&B Growth In today’s competitive F&B scene, relying solely on email campaigns is no longer enough. WhatsApp marketing offers higher visibility, better engagement, and measurable results — making it the smarter way to grow customer loyalty and revenue.
